Rapid-Rate Thermal Cycle Chamber

  • Uniformity, reproducibility
    Wind simulation allows achieving minimum temperature variations of the specimen, for accurate and quick temperature changes. Specimen temperature ramp rate is
    15°C/min, air temperature ramp rate is
    23°C/min.
  • Greater temperature ramp control
    High precision of the specimen temperature control achieved thanks to a sensor for temperature specimen measurement, and the embedded high-speed controller.
    In addition:
    - refrigeration capacities increased at low temperatures,
    - minimization of the difference between test area and specimen temperatures,
    - airflow speed uniformity,
    lead to excellent temperature ramp control.
  • Selection of the temperature control mode
    Two temperature control modes are available:
    - A specimen temperature control mode meeting ramp rate conditions of JEDEC standard (15°C/min.)
    - An air temperature control mode for temperature cycle tests.
  • Free access
    Cable ports are equipped on both left and right side, to ease specimen access and wiring.
